Maximizing Efficiency: The Battle Between ChatGPT and Manual Writing
In today's fast-paced digital world, the battle between ChatGPT and manual content writing continues to evolve. Maximizing efficiency is key when it comes to producing high-quality content that resonates with audiences. ChatGPT, an AI-powered tool, offers speed and scalability, while manual writing allows for a personal touch and in-depth research. Both methods have their strengths and weaknesses, making it essential to find the right balance for your content strategy.
When it comes to maximizing efficiency, ChatGPT excels in generating large volumes of content quickly. This can be especially useful for businesses looking to scale their content production or meet tight deadlines. On the other hand, manual content writing allows for a more personalized approach, with writers able to inject their unique voice and perspective into the content. While this method may take longer, the end result is often more engaging and tailored to the target audience.
In the battle between ChatGPT and manual writing, striking a balance is key. By leveraging the strengths of both methods, businesses can create content that is not only efficient but also impactful. Whether it's using ChatGPT to generate initial drafts and then refining them with manual edits, or incorporating AI-powered insights into manual writing processes, finding the right combination is essential for success in 2025 and beyond. Ultimately, the most effective approach will depend on the specific goals and needs of each individual business.
